		<description>Didier. I enjoyed the Beatles story.

PPM dashboards are often considered tools that give our executives some clarity about why a project is important to the business.  For your article I see a case for sharing the same information with the project team members so they can appreciate why their contribution drives the business strategy and revenue.</description>
